Persecuted Christians

Scripture

18 “If the world hates you, you know that it hated Me before it hated you. 19 If you were of the world, the world would love its own. Yet because you are not of the world, but I chose you out of the world, therefore the world hates you.20 Remember the word that I said to you, ‘A servant is not greater than his master.’ If they persecuted Me, they will also persecute you. If they kept My word, they will keep yours also.

John 15:18-20

Have you or anyone you know ever been mistreated for your Christian belief? In many parts of the world Christians are persecuted and treated as second class citizens. Recently in China there has been an upsurge of state sponsored hatred towards Christian minorities. That’s just one example. We are called to pray and do whatever we can for our brothers and sisters facing persecution including the risk of death for being followers of Jesus.
